Transaction 3494d772348dc04b1a1381f60d11f87d15e8148d1347e2781629078a33db3417
1 Input
2 Outputs
- 3494d772348dc04b1a1381f60d11f87d15e8148d1347e2781629078a33db3417:0
- 3494d772348dc04b1a1381f60d11f87d15e8148d1347e2781629078a33db3417:1
value 37500000
address 14zhiB4EnBidbCZ7PSTgBUGz5A4moZBznW
value 14804
address 13ivhmGfyeUijvheAr95FWpAK2AQ8odsVu